A strong correlation between the vertical velocity and temperature is observed in the turbulent regime at almost all the length scales. Frequency spectra of all the velocities and temperature show a $-5/3$ law for a wide band of frequencies. The variances of horizontal velocities at different points in the flow yield a single power-law.
